Los Angeles is a city that offers opportunities in many fields, specifically in the modeling field. Modeling is a demanding industry that places pressure on models to conform to industry demands in order to retain employment in the industry. Many times models are pressured into decisions though sexual harassment.
The legal protection against the sexual harassment present in modeling in Los Angeles is covered under both California laws and federal laws. Sexual harassment can occur in situations when something happens because of something else, otherwise known as a quid pro quo. This type of workplace harassment causes a hostile work environment and can be as simple as an inappropriate joke.
Models are often young women who work in the modeling industry as independent contractors with little job security. When sexual harassment occurs the models do not speak out about the harassment out of fear of losing their jobs. The competitiveness of the modeling industry causes victims of sexual harassment to endure the harassment to ensure job security.
The presence of sexual harassment and the pressures within the modeling industry have gained national attention. Model Sara Ziff has created the Model Alliance, an organization that is focused on improving the working conditions for models and providing more protections for models. The Model Alliance has established a confidential reporting system for models to report improper behavior.
The modeling industry is a competitive industry that has many pitfalls, especially for young models. Modeling is freelance employment where models are often treated as commodities. Models fall victim to industry pressures in an effort to ensure their continued employment. These pressures are often a type of sexual harassment. Sexual harassment is prohibited in the workplace and all employees should understand their rights against sexual harassment.
